Separate Evaluation of Nonlinearity- Due Q Penalties in Long-Haul Very Dense Wdm Optical Systems. Paradiso, L.; Boffi, P.; Marazzi, L.; Dalla, N.; Massimo, V.; and Martinelli, M. In IFIP Advances in Information and Communication Technology, volume 164, pages 313-318, 2000. Springer New York LLC.
Website abstract bibtex Nonlinearity-due Q penalties are experimentally evaluated on a 2000-km, 33- GHz spaced DWDM system, dependently on system length and channel spacing. SPM, FWM and XPM, which is found to be the major constrain, are separately addressed. © 2005 by International Federation for Information Processing.
